Lyn77 wrote on Thu Feb 25, 2021 2:22pm:

I had a bottle of butano from Cepsa (aluminium bottle) delivered to my home this week.  They and Repsol (orange bottle)  both do home deliveries.  I use Repsol for cooking because we rent our house and they came with the contract.  I use the aluminium ones  for our heater...

... in the lounge rather than sticking to the central heating all the time which is electric and expensive.i paid 15.90 for the bottle this week and i have never found them more expensive than the orange ones.  They are all more expensive in the winter, the best time to buy is the summer when they come down in price.

Yes that’s fine the silver bottles are lightweight. The orange bottles are regulated by the government so the price is the same everywhere the silver bottle prices vary depending on we’re you buy them. But they contents are the same ..
